For Drew Honey, senior year was supposed to be a straightforward final stretch—keep her head down, finish her degree, and launch into her future. That plan disintegrated the moment Adrian Jackson entered her life. What began as a comfortable collegiate living situation quickly spiraled into a magnetic, undeniable connection that neither could walk away from. But timing is a cruel mistress, and just as they found their footing, a crushing life circumstance forced them to move on, leaving their hearts tethered to the "what-ifs" of their youth.
Five years later, fate orchestrates a serendipitous reunion in the humid heat of Baton Rouge. Adrian has returned to the city where she left a piece of her soul behind, never expecting to collide with Drew in the aisles of a store. That chance encounter ignites the embers of a love that never truly burned out.
This isn’t just a simple homecoming; it is a raw, tender journey of rediscovery. As they navigate the lingering ghosts of past trauma and the anxieties of adulthood, Drew and Adrian must learn if their bond can survive a second chance. Sweet Like Honey is a poignant, soul-stirring exploration of healing, courage, and the kind of love that lingers long after it has been found.
